Lerarenopleiding Leuven DB - UniCat UR - https://www.unicat.be/uniCat?func=search&query=sysid:137575738 AB - The world we live in becomes smaller and smaller due to globalisation that causes a worldwide interconnectedness. Therefore, there is a need for bringing international competences to the classroom in order prepare students for global citizenship. Literature study shows, however, that there is still a shortage of available material teachers can consult to teach and improve students' international competences. This research is therefore based on the question how teachers can work on international competences in the second grade ASOI, and more specifically, how they can work on international competences by exposing gender stereotypes during the English literature class. To achieve this, a lesson series on gender stereotypes is developed for the same target group. This lesson kit can serve as a source of inspiration for teachers to teach international competences in their own class, as professionals in the field find that this lesson series is well-balanced and contains learning activities that work on these competences in a creative and efficient way.
